Does Jet Blue charge for baggage?
No, they are one of the rare animals that still allows 1 free checked bag and gives you assigned seating FREE too. They have TVs at every seat, which is a plus when traveling with kids. And snacks! You do have to bring your own headset for the TV/or radio. If you forget you can buy one for $2.
